CVE-2025-71389
קריטית 10.0
תיאור (מקור, אנגלית)
Cal.com (calcom/cal.diy) before 5.9.9 is vulnerable to unauthenticated remote code execution because it bundles a version of Next.js whose React Server Components (RSC) request handling deserializes attacker-controlled input. A remote attacker can send a crafted RSC request to the server and cause arbitrary code to be executed during server-side processing, without authentication or user interaction. The flaw derives from the upstream Next.js vulnerability CVE-2025-55182 and is resolved in 5.9.9 by updating the affected dependency.
